Spa Sign: The Importance of Aesthetic and Legibility

For a spa to attract and retain clients, it's essential to create an inviting atmosphere that reflects the brand's personality and values. One crucial aspect of this is the sign that welcomes customers to the spa. A well-designed spa sign can make a lasting impression on visitors and set the tone for their experience. A good spa sign should be both aesthetically pleasing and easy to read from a distance. The goal is to create a sense of calmness and serenity, which is often associated with spas. The design and layout of the sign should reflect this ambiance, using calming colors and gentle typography. The sign should also clearly communicate the spa's services and offerings. This includes the name of the spa, its location, and any special features or treatments it offers. Clear and concise messaging is essential to ensure that visitors can quickly understand what the spa has to offer. In addition to aesthetics and legibility, a spa sign should also be durable and long-lasting. The materials used for the sign should withstand various weather conditions, such as rain, snow, and direct sunlight. A well-designed spa sign can last for years with proper maintenance.
